UITIC congress in Porto sold out
The 20th edition of the UITIC (International Union of Shoe Industry Technicians) Congress in Porto (May 16-18) has had to turn away people who wanted to attend. In the days leading up to the event, UITIC had to hang up the ‘Sold Out’ sign as footwear industry professionals continued to attempt to register for the event.

Joint organiser, Leandro de Melo, vice-president of UITIC, told footwearbiz on May 16: “We simply reached the point at which we had to turn people away because the congress hotels are completely full and there is no way we can fit any more people into the auditorium.” UITIC president, Yves Morin, said there had been a record level of registrations, with the total number of delegates likely to exceed 500 people from 30 different countries.

With ‘From Fashion to Factory: A New Technological Age’ as the theme of the congress, delegates visited factories in the region around Porto on May 15 and 16 before two days of presentations and discussions.
